By Peter White Television Editor Canada’s CBC has picked up buzzy Hulu and BBC drama Normal People. The Canadian public broadcaster will air the coming-of-age drama, based on Sally Rooney’s best-selling novel on its streaming service from May 27.
Two episodes of the Hulu and BBC co-production, which stars Daisy Edgar-Jones and Paul Mescal, will air weekly. This comes as the 12-part series, featuring half-hour episodes, propelled British streaming network BBC Three to its best-ever week when it launched last month, generating 12.6M views in its first week.
